指定服务器管理器数据刷新周期,Windows Server Update Services (Configuration Manager) WSUS 维护指南 - Configuration Mana...

本文提供了一份详细的指南,介绍如何在Configuration Manager环境中正确维护WSUS服务器,包括备份数据库、创建自定义索引、拒绝取代的更新、执行清理任务以及自动化维护流程。建议每月执行维护,确保WSUS和Configuration Manager的性能和客户端更新的顺畅。从版本1906开始,Configuration Manager提供了自动清理选项,但仍需关注数据库备份和重新索引。
摘要由CSDN通过智能技术生成

WSUS 和 Configuration Manager SUP 维护的完整指南

12/21/2020

本文内容

本文解决有关 Configuration Manager 环境的 WSUS 维护的一些常见问题。

原始产品版本:  Windows服务器、Windows Server Update Services、Configuration Manager

原始 KB 编号:   4490644

简介

问题通常与如何在 Configuration Manager 环境中正确运行此维护或运行此维护的运行时间一 样。 配置管理器管理员并不了解应运行 WSUS 维护的情况很常见。 我们中的大多数人只是设置 WSUS 服务器,因为它是 SUP (必备) 。 设置 SUP 后,我们关闭 WSUS 控制台并冒充它不存在。 遗憾的是,它对于 Configuration Manager 客户端和 WSUS/SUP 服务器的整体性能可能存在问题。

在了解需要完成此维护之后,你会想知道需要执行哪些维护以及需要执行维护多久。 答案是您应执行每月维护。 维护非常简单,对于从一开始就得到良好维护的 WSUS 服务器来说,无需很长时间。 但是,如果完成 WSUS 维护后已经过一段时间,则首次清理可能比较困难或耗时。 在随后的几个月中,它将容易得多或更快。

在支持 Configuration Manager 当前分支版本 1906 和更高版本的同时维护 WSUS

如果使用的是 Configuration Manager 当前分支版本 1906 或更高版本,我们建议您在顶级站点的软件更新点配置中启用 WSUS 维护选项,以在每个同步后自动执行清理过程。 它可有效处理本文中所述的所有清理操作,但 WSUS 数据库的备份和重新索引除外。 您仍应按计划自动备份 WSUS 数据库以及重新索引 WSUS 数据库。

59ed4c12c70d3e5f38b014fdf61b4e92.png

有关 Configuration Manager 中软件更新维护的信息,请参阅 软件更新维护。

重要的注意事项

备注

如果你正在利用 Configuration Manager 版本 1906中添加的维护功能,则无需考虑这些项目,因为 Configuration Manager 在每个同步后会处理清理。

在开始维护过程之前,请阅读本文中所有的信息和说明。

将 WSUS 与下游服务器一同使用时,WSUS 服务器从上到下添加,但应从底部向上删除。 同步或添加更新时,它们首先会转到上游 WSUS 服务器,然后向下复制到下游服务器。 执行清理操作并删除 WSUS 服务器中的项目时,应从层次结构底部开始。

WSUS 维护可以在同一层中的多台服务器上同时执行。 执行此操作时,请确保先完成一层,然后再移动到下一层。 下面的清理和重新索引步骤应在所有 WSUS 服务器上运行,而不管它们是否是副本 WSUS 服务器。 有关确定 WSUS 服务器是否为副本的信息,请参阅拒绝 取代的更新。

确保 SSP 在维护过程中不同步,因为它可能会导致丢失一些已完成的工作。 检查 SUP 同步计划,并在此过程中临时设置为手动。

7dc44e85653314819251711fe5eb23c0.png

如果主站点或管理中心有多个 SSP 位于 (CAS) 其中不共享 SUSDB,请考虑与网站上第一个 SUP 同步的 WSUS 服务器驻留在网站下面的层中。 例如,我的 CAS 网站有两个 SSP:

名为 New syncs with Microsoft Update 的一个,它在我的第一层 (Tier1) 。

名为 2012 的服务器与 New 同步,它将视为第二层。 可以在我执行所有其他 Tier2 服务器(例如主网站的单个 SUP)的同时清理它。

8977ee825030ede7d98dea7df394f4d0.png

执行 WSUS 维护

正确维护 WSUS 所需的基本步骤包括:

备份 WSUS 数据库

使用所需方法 (SUSDB) WSUS 数据库。 有关详细信息,请参阅 创建完整数据库备份。

创建自定义索引

虽然此过程是可选的,但建议使用,它会在后续清理操作期间显著提高性能。

如果使用的是 Configuration Manager 当前分支版本 1906 或更高版本,建议使用 Configuration Manager 创建索引。 若要创建索引,在最高网站的软件更新点配置中配置"向 WSUS 数据库添加非群集索引"选项。

ce67aa765a9d5e4f62b94c5ec819ffbc.png

如果使用旧版 Configuration Manager 或独立 WSUS 服务器,请按照以下步骤在 SUSDB 数据库中创建自定义索引。 对于每个 SUSDB,这是一个一次过程。

确保您具有 SUSDB数据库的备份。

使用 SQL Management Studio 以与重新索引WSUS数据库一节中所述的相同方式连接到 SUSDB 数据库。

对 SUSDB 运行以下脚本,以创建两个自定义索引:

-- Create custom index in tbLocalizedPropertyForRevision

USE [SUSDB]

CREATE NONCLUSTERED INDEX [nclLocalizedPropertyID] ON [dbo].[tbLocalizedPropertyForRevision]

(

[LocalizedPropertyID] ASC

)WITH (PAD_INDEX = OFF, STATISTICS_NORECOMPUTE = OFF, SORT_IN_TEMPDB = OFF, DROP_EXISTING = OFF, ONLINE =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Y]

-- Create custom index in tbRevisionSupersedesUpdate

CREATE NONCLUSTERED INDEX [nclSupercededUpdateID] ON [dbo].[tbRevisionSupersedesUpdate]

(

[SupersededUpdateID] ASC

)WITH (PAD_INDEX = OFF, STATISTICS_NORECOMPUTE = OFF, SORT_IN_TEMPDB = OFF, DROP_EXISTING = OFF, ONLINE =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Y]

如果之前已创建自定义索引,则再次运行脚本会导致类似以下错误:

Msg 1913,级别 16,状态 1,第 4 行

操作失败,因为表"dbo.tbLocalizedPropertyForRevision"上已存在名称为"nclLocalizedPropertyID"的索引或统计信息。

对 WSUS 数据库重新建立索引

若要将 WSUS 数据库重新 (SUSDB) ,请使用重新索引WSUS数据库 T-SQL 脚本。

连接到 SUSDB 并执行重新索引的步骤有所不同,具体取决于 SUSDB 是在 SQL SERVER 中运行,还是Windows 内部数据库 (WID) 。 若要确定运行 SUSDB 的位置,请检查位于子项的 SQLServerName WSUS 服务器上注册表 HKEY_LOCAL_MACHINE\Software\Microsoft\Update Services\Server\Setup 项的值。

如果值仅包含服务器名称或 server\instance,则 SUSDB 将运行在SQL Server。 如果值包含字符串或字符串 ##SSEE ##WID ,则 SUSDB 在 WID 中运行,如下所示:

8f0bae5bec9d03787654e7e72951a9d5.png

670bdbfa40f71d3e3f5f7a86fb29687a.png

如果 SUSDB 已安装在 WID 上

如果 SUSDB 安装在 WID 上,SQL Server Management Studio Express 必须本地安装以运行重新索引脚本。 下面是确定要安装的 SQL Server Management Studio Express 的一种简单方法:

对于Windows S

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值